“Freedom Nr. 39-145” is a dance performance, an attempt to, a search for; freedom. Together with the acting students of the 3rd year, Choreographer Edith Buttingsrud Pedersen questions our ideas of freedom. What are we talking about when we wish for freedom: freedom from what? and freedom to what? How does freedom connect with individuality? Can we be free and still belong? "Maybe the only way to be really free is not to exist, to be free from our bodies, from this planet, from war, from hunger, from judgments, freedom to cry, freedom to cry anywhere, and freedom to die.”
With expressivity and a fine sense of capturing the mechanisms that govern our daily existence, this performance is a reflection of a world in desperate search of meaning.
